CITY OF WAUKEE: Fleet Farm Holds "Ribbon-Cutting", Opens Waukee Location

Ribbon cut

City of Waukee issued the following announcement on Aug. 27. 

On Aug. 26, 2020, Fleet Farm staff, Waukee City officials, Waukee Area Chamber of Commerce members, non-profit partners and more, gathered (distanced, of course) to tour and celebrate the upcoming grand opening of Fleet Farm’s new Kettlestone location. The new store is located at 1300 SE Kettlestone Blvd. It is now open to the public!

Waukee Mayor Courtney Clarke spoke at the ribbon-cutting event, which was really a "log-sawing" ceremony. City Council Members Chris Crone and Ben Sinclair were also present.

"With Fleet Farm’s unique offering of products and services, our residents and the broader regional community will be well served. Thank you to Fleet Farm for recognizing the many benefits of our city and choosing to make Waukee your newest home."

Customers can find fishing, hunting and outdoor products, auto parts, farm and pet supplies, home improvement and household goods, clothing and footwear, and much more. The new retail center is employing roughly 200 people.
